    Verint Announces Q2 Results

    9/2/25 4:05:00 PM ET
    $VRNT
    EDP Services
    Technology
    Get the next $VRNT alert in real time by email

    Verint® (NASDAQ:VRNT), The CX Automation Company™, today announced results for the three and six months ended July 31, 2025 (FYE 2026).

    "I am pleased to report strong Q2 results and continued AI momentum. In Q2, AI ARR increased 21% year-over-year reflecting the strong AI business outcomes we deliver to our customers. Behind our results is our CX Automation category leadership and we believe AI adoption in the CX market is still in early stages. We recently announced that Verint agreed to be acquired by Thoma Bravo to continue our CX Automation journey as a private company. Their $2B investment in Verint represents a strong validation of our CX Automation strategy and we look forward to extending our category leadership together with Thoma Bravo," said Dan Bodner CEO and Chairman.

    Pending Acquisition by Thoma Bravo

    As previously announced, on August 24, 2025, Verint entered into a definitive agreement to be acquired by Thoma Bravo, a leading software investment firm, in an all-cash transaction reflecting an enterprise value of $2 billion. Under the terms of the agreement, Verint common shareholders will receive $20.50 per share in cash, an 18% premium to Verint's 10-day volume weighted average share price up to June 25, 2025 (unaffected share price), the last day prior to media reports regarding a potential sale of the company. The transaction, which was unanimously approved by the Verint Board of Directors, is expected to close before the end of Verint's current fiscal year, subject to customary closing conditions, including approval by Verint shareholders and the receipt of required regulatory approvals. Under the agreement, a Thoma Bravo-controlled entity will act as the parent in a reverse-triangular merger. The transaction is not subject to a financing condition. Upon completion of the transaction, Verint common stock will no longer be listed on any public stock exchange.

    As previously disclosed, given the pending transaction, Verint will not be hosting an earnings conference call, and is suspending its practice of providing financial guidance.

    About Verint Systems Inc.

    Verint® (NASDAQ:VRNT) is a leader in Customer Experience (CX) Automation, serving a customer base that includes more than 80 of the Fortune 100 companies. The world's most iconic brands use the Verint Open Platform and our team of AI-powered bots to deliver tangible AI Business Outcomes, Now™ across the enterprise. Verint is uniquely positioned to help brands increase CX Automation with our differentiated, AI-powered Open Platform.

    Our non-GAAP financial measures are calculated by making the following adjustments to our GAAP financial measures:

    Amortization of acquired technology and other acquired intangible assets. When we acquire an entity, we are required under GAAP to record the fair values of the intangible assets of the acquired entity and amortize those assets over their useful lives. We exclude the amortization of acquired intangible assets, including acquired technology, from our non-GAAP financial measures because they are inconsistent in amount and frequency and are significantly impacted by the timing and size of acquisitions. We also exclude these amounts to provide easier comparability of pre- and post-acquisition operating results.

    Stock-based compensation expenses. We exclude stock-based compensation expenses related to restricted stock unit and performance stock unit awards, stock bonus programs, bonus share programs, and other stock-based awards from our non-GAAP financial measures. We evaluate our performance both with and without these measures because stock-based compensation is typically a non-cash expense and can vary significantly over time based on the timing, size and nature of awards granted, and is influenced in part by certain factors which are generally beyond our control, such as the volatility of the price of our common stock. In addition, measurement of stock-based compensation is subject to varying valuation methodologies and subjective assumptions, and therefore we believe that excluding stock-based compensation from our non-GAAP financial measures allows for meaningful comparisons of our current operating results to our historical operating results and to other companies in our industry.

    Acquisition and divestitures expenses (benefit), net. In connection with acquisition activity (including with respect to acquisitions that are not consummated), we incur expenses (benefits), including legal, accounting, and other professional fees, integration costs, changes in the fair value of contingent consideration obligations, and other costs. Integration costs may consist of information technology expenses as systems are integrated across the combined entity, consulting expenses, marketing expenses, and professional fees, as well as non-cash charges to write-off or impair the value of redundant assets. In connection with divestiture activity, we exclude the gain or loss on divestiture as well as any expenses incurred, including legal, accounting, and other professional fees. We exclude these expenses from our non-GAAP financial measures because they are unpredictable, can vary based on the size and complexity of each transaction, and are unrelated to our continuing operations or to the continuing operations of the acquired businesses.

    Restructuring expenses (benefit). We exclude restructuring expenses (benefit) from our non-GAAP financial measures, which include employee termination costs, facility exit costs, certain professional fees, asset impairment charges (except as included in acquisition), and other costs directly associated with resource realignments incurred in reaction to changing strategies or business conditions. All of these costs can vary significantly in amount and frequency based on the nature of the actions as well as the changing needs of our business and we believe that excluding them provides easier comparability of pre- and post-restructuring operating results.

    Impairment charges and other adjustments. We exclude from our non-GAAP financial measures asset impairment charges (other than those already included within restructuring or acquisition), rent expense for redundant facilities, gains or losses on sales of property, gains or losses on settlements of certain legal matters, and certain professional fees unrelated to our ongoing operations, all of which are unusual in nature and can vary significantly in amount and frequency. We also exclude from our non-GAAP financial measures separation expenses incurred in connection with the spin-off of our former Cyber Intelligence Solutions business, including insurance and other expense adjustments associated with a tax-related indemnification asset as a result of the spin-off. These costs were incremental to our normal operating expenses and were incurred solely as a result of the separation transaction.

    Non-GAAP income tax adjustments. We exclude from our non-GAAP measures of net income attributable to Verint Systems Inc., our GAAP provision for (benefit from) income taxes and instead include a non-GAAP provision for income taxes, determined by applying a non-GAAP effective income tax rate to our income before provision for income taxes, as adjusted for the non-GAAP items described above. The non-GAAP effective income tax rate is generally based upon the income taxes we expect to pay in the reporting year. Our GAAP effective income tax rate can vary significantly from year to year as a result of tax law changes, settlements with tax authorities, changes in the geographic mix of earnings including acquisition activity, changes in the projected realizability of deferred tax assets, and other unusual or period-specific events, all of which can vary in size and frequency. We believe that our non-GAAP effective income tax rate removes much of this variability and facilitates meaningful comparisons of operating results across periods. Our non-GAAP effective income tax rate for this year is currently approximately 10% and was 12% for the year ended January 31, 2025. We evaluate our non-GAAP effective income tax rate on an ongoing basis, and it can change from time to time. Our non-GAAP income tax rate can differ materially from our GAAP effective income tax rate.

    Definition of Certain Non-GAAP Financial Metrics

    Adjusted EBITDA is a non-GAAP measure defined as net income (loss) before interest expense, interest income, income taxes, depreciation expense, amortization expense, stock-based compensation expenses, revenue adjustments, restructuring expenses, acquisition expenses, and other expenses excluded from our non-GAAP financial measures as described above. We believe that adjusted EBITDA is also commonly used by investors to evaluate operating performance between companies because it helps reduce variability caused by differences in capital structures, income taxes, stock-based compensation expenses, accounting policies, and depreciation and amortization policies. Adjusted EBITDA is also used by credit rating agencies, lenders, and other parties to evaluate our creditworthiness.

    Net Debt is a non-GAAP measure defined as the sum of long-term and short-term debt on our consolidated balance sheet, excluding unamortized discounts and issuance costs, less the sum of cash and cash equivalents, restricted cash, restricted cash equivalents, restricted bank time deposits, and restricted investments (including long-term portions), and short-term investments. We use this non-GAAP financial measure to help evaluate our capital structure, financial leverage, and our ability to reduce debt and to fund investing and financing activities and believe that it provides useful information to investors.

    Free Cash Flow is a non-GAAP measure defined as GAAP cash provided by operating activities less our capital expenditures, which include purchases of property and equipment and capitalized software development costs.

    Recurring revenue, on both a GAAP and non-GAAP basis, is the portion of our revenue that we believe is likely to be renewed in the future, and primarily consists of SaaS revenue, optional managed services revenue and initial and renewal post contract support.

    Nonrecurring perpetual revenue, on both a GAAP and non-GAAP basis, primarily consists of our perpetual licenses and hardware.

    Nonrecurring professional services and other revenue, on both a GAAP and non-GAAP basis, primarily consists of our installation services, business advisory consulting and training services, and patent royalties.

    SaaS revenue, on both a GAAP and non-GAAP basis, includes bundled SaaS, software with standard managed services and unbundled SaaS (including associated support) that we account for as term licenses where managed services are purchased separately.

    Supplemental Information About Constant Currency

    Because we operate on a global basis and transact business in many currencies, fluctuations in foreign currency exchange rates can affect our consolidated U.S. dollar operating results. To facilitate the assessment of our performance excluding the effect of foreign currency exchange rate fluctuations, we calculate our revenue, GAAP and non-GAAP cost of revenue, and GAAP and non-GAAP operating expenses on both an as-reported basis and a constant currency basis, allowing for comparison of results between periods as if foreign currency exchange rates had remained constant. We perform our constant currency calculations by translating current-period results into U.S. dollars using prior-period average foreign currency exchange rates or hedge rates, as applicable, rather than current period exchange rates. We believe that constant currency measures, which exclude the impact of changes in foreign currency exchange rates, facilitate the assessment of underlying business trends.

    Unless otherwise indicated, our financial outlook, which is provided on a non-GAAP basis, reflects foreign currency exchange rates approximately consistent with rates in effect when the outlook is provided.

    We also incur foreign exchange gains and losses resulting from the revaluation and settlement of monetary assets and liabilities that are denominated in currencies other than the entity's functional currency. Our financial outlook for diluted earnings per share includes net foreign exchange gains or losses incurred to date, if any, but does not include potential future gains or losses.

    Operating Metrics

    Subscription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R) represents the annualized quarterly run-rate value of our active or signed subscription agreements at the end of the period and is comprised of the ARR calculated for our SaaS, Support, and Optional Managed Services contracts. Under ASC Topic 606, Revenue from Contracts with Customers, we are required to recognize a significant portion of our Unbundled SaaS contracts at a point in time when the software is first made available to the customer, or at the beginning of the subscription term, despite the fact that our contracts typically call for billing these amounts annually or more frequently over the life of the subscription. This point-in-time recognition of a portion of our recurring revenue creates significant variability in the revenue recognized period to period based on the timing of the subscription start date and the subscription term and can create a significant difference between the timing of our revenue recognition and the actual customer billing under the contract. We use ARR to measure the underlying performance of our subscription-based contracts and mitigate the impact of this variability as ARR reduces fluctuations due to seasonality, contract term, and the sales mix of subscriptions. ARR should be viewed independently of revenue, and does not represent our revenue under ASC 606 on an annualized basis, as it is an operating metric that is impacted by contract start and end dates and renewal rates. ARR is not intended to be a replacement for forecasts of revenue and does not include revenue reported as nonrecurring revenue in our consolidated statement of operations. ARR does not have any standardized meaning and is therefore unlikely to be comparable to similarly titled measures presented by other companies. Investors should consider our ARR operating measure only in conjunction with our GAAP financial results.

    AI Annual Recurring Revenue (AI ARR) is the portion of ARR that is derived from solutions that include AI-functionality, and represents the annualized quarterly run-rate value of the associated active or signed SaaS agreements as of the end of a period. At present, these AI solutions are hosted by Verint.

    Non-AI Annual Recurring Revenue (Non-AI ARR) is the portion of ARR that is derived from our SaaS, Support, and Optional Managed Services contracts that do not include AI-functionality, and represents the annualized quarterly run rate of such active or signed agreements as of the end of a period.

    Cash Generation represents the sum of ARR and nonrecurring perpetual and nonrecurring professional services and other revenue and provides an estimate of the cash-producing potential of our entire business.

    Cash Contribution is defined as Cash Generation less non-GAAP cost of revenue and operating expenses and helps assess how effectively we convert our revenue streams into cash.
